Description (What the record is about)
-
Charles Cave for Thomas Daniel & Co. (London) to Boulton Watt & Co. (Soho). 21 Aug. 1845. Boulton Watt & Co. (Soho) to Thomas Daniel & Co. (London). 22 Aug. 1845. Charles Cave for Thomas Daniel & Co. (London) to Boulton Watt & Co. (Soho). 23 Aug. 1845. Docketed “Copy of correspondence with Thomas Daniel & Co. respecting their account. 25 Aug. 1845.”
